Loose flange

Loose flange is a pipe connection flange that does not require welding and is mainly connected to the pipe by bolts and gaskets. Unlike traditional welded flanges, the design of loose flanges allows a certain amount of loose space between the flange and the pipe, so that the flange can be easily disassembled and replaced. It is widely used in pipeline systems that need to be regularly disassembled, inspected or repaired, especially for medium and low pressure pipelines and working conditions. The advantages of loose flanges are the ease of installation and disassembly, reduced maintenance costs and flexibility. They are widely used in many industrial fields, such as chemical, electric power, oil and gas, water supply and drainage and other pipeline connection systems.

3. Technical parameters

Material Carbon steel, stainless steel, alloy steel, cast steel, etc.
Specification

DN15 ~ DN1200(1/2" ~ 48")

Pressure level

PN6 ~ PN40

standard Comply with international standards such as GB, ANSI, DIN, JIS, etc.
Surface treatment Spraying, galvanizing, phosphating, etc.
Connection Bolted connections
Temperature range

-20°C ~ 250°C

Pipe wall thickness Suitable for different pipe wall thicknesses, can be customized according to customer requirements

7. Notes

Installation Note: Ensure that the flange sealing surface is clean to avoid contamination or impurities that affect the sealing effect.

Tighten the bolts: During installation, tighten the bolts evenly to ensure that the flange connection is stable.

Regular inspection: Regularly check the bolts and sealing gaskets at the flange connection to avoid leakage due to looseness or wear.

Use environment: When selecting a loose flange, the pressure, temperature and working environment of the pipeline should be considered to ensure that the appropriate material and specifications are selected.
